UN's Plumbly lauds LAF, security forces for safeguarding Lebanon
United Nations Special Coordinator for Lebanon Derek Plumbly issued on Thursday a statement whereby he said he was delighted to be back in Tripoli and see its residents able to move freely after the implementation of the security plan.

Plumbly also thanked Mufti of Tripoli and the North Sheikh Malek Chaar for receiving him at his residence in Lebanon's northern city.

"I seize this opportunity to pay tribute to the Lebanese army and the security forces for safeguarding security and stability in Tripoli recently and across the country," Plumbly said.

In this regard, he noted that it is also an opportunity to recognize the "difficult work" of the Lebanese Armed Forces and security forces in ending terrorism.

"Events which have recently occurred in Beirut and the Bekaa reminded us how valuable that security is," Plumbly said, noting that he had the opportunity to tour Tripoli's Syria Street for the first time earlier Thursday.

"I visited a project where women from Jabal Mohsen and Bab El-Tabbaneh are working together," Plumbly said, adding that he is aware of the dire socio-economic situation as well as the need for longer-term development.

The UN official also said he is discussing with a number of UN agencies what more the United Nations can do to help in this regard.
